Allen-Bradley PowerFlex 70 Fault Codes
The Allen-Bradley PowerFlex 70 is a mid-range VFD rated 0.37ΓÇô448 kW. Fault codes display on the HIM (Human Interface Module) as fault numbers. The PowerFlex 70 uses a similar fault structure to the PF700 and PF755 but with its own parameters (accessible via Connected Components Workbench or DriveExplorer).
PowerFlex 70 Fault Code Table
| Code | Fault Description | Common Cause | Action |
|---|---|---|---|
| F2 | Auxiliary input | External fault from TB6 | Check external fault wiring |
| F3 | Power loss | Input power interruption | Check supply voltage |
| F4 | Undervoltage | Low supply voltage | Verify input voltage |
| F5 | Overvoltage | Regenerative energy or voltage spike | Add brake resistor |
| F6 | Motor stall | Motor stalled or overloaded | Check mechanical load |
| F7 | Motor overcurrent | Motor overload or winding fault | Check motor amps and winding |
| F8 | Heatsink overtemperature | High ambient or blocked cooling | Clean fins, check fan |
| F12 | HW overcurrent | Hardware overcurrent (fast) | Check for short circuit |
| F13 | Ground fault | Motor winding or cable ground | Megger test motor |
| F15 | Load loss | Belt broken or load disconnect | Check mechanical connection |
| F23 | Auto tune fault | Motor data entry error | Verify motor nameplate data |
| F25 | Drive overtemperature | Internal temperature high | Check cooling system |
| F33 | Start inhibit | Safety input or logic inhibit | Check digital input wiring |
| F38 | Phase loss | Output phase missing | Check motor connections |
| F63 | Software fault | Parameter or firmware issue | Reset and reload parameters |
| F111 | Internal fault | Hardware fault | Contact Rockwell support |
Most Common PowerFlex 70 Faults
F7 ΓÇö Motor Overcurrent
Check motor nameplate FLA vs. parameter P032 (motor NP amps). Verify correct motor overload setting. Check motor for single-phasing, winding imbalance, or locked rotor condition. Increase accel time (parameter A051).
F8 ΓÇö Heatsink Overtemperature
The PowerFlex 70 requires 3-inch clearance on all sides. Clean fins with compressed air ΓÇö debris accumulates on the cooling fins rapidly in industrial environments. Check internal cooling fan (starts automatically with drive power).
F13 ΓÇö Ground Fault
Disconnect motor leads at drive output terminals. Megger test each conductor to ground at 1000 VDC. Reading below 1 MΩ indicates a failed cable or motor winding. Also check cable tray for damaged insulation.
F5 ΓÇö Overvoltage
Pumping applications with fast deceleration cause motor regeneration. Increase deceleration ramp time (parameter A052). If regeneration is unavoidable, add a dynamic braking resistor to the brake resistor terminals.

Pro tip: PowerFlex 70 stores fault queue (F01–F08 parameters in the fault log group). Access via HIM: DIAGNOSTICS → FAULT LOG. Always review the full fault queue — a single event often produces multiple faults in sequence that tell the root cause story.
